Tuesday Is Your Last Chance To Buy OP Bancorp Before The Dividend Payout
OP Bancorp will pay shareholders a quarterly dividend of 12 cents per share. The company will go ex-dividend on Wednesday. The stock will likely open 12 cents lower than it would on any other day. Tuesday marks the last chance for investors to receive the next dividend payout from OP Bancorpor.

About OPBK
OP Bancorp is the holding company for Open Bank (the Bank). The Bank is engaged in commercial banking business in Los Angeles, Orange, and Santa Clara Counties in California, the Dallas metropolitan area in Texas, and Clark County in Nevada. The Bank is focused on serving the banking needs of small- and medium-sized businesses, professionals, and residents with a particular emphasis on Korean and other ethnic minority communities. The Bank’s lending activities are diversified and include commercial real estate, commercial and industrial, small business administration (SBA), home mortgage, and consumer loans. The Bank attracts retail deposits through its branch network which offers a range of deposit products for business and consumer banking customers. The Bank operates about 11 full-service branch offices in Downtown Los Angeles, Los Angeles Fashion District, Los Angeles Koreatown, Cerritos, Gardena, Buena Park, and Santa Clara, California, Carrollton, Texas and Las Vegas, Nevada.
